What Conditions Qualify for a Florida Medical Marijuana Card?

In Florida, the list of qualifying conditions for a medical marijuana card includes but is not limited to:

  • Chronic pain (non-malignant)
  •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D)
  • Anxiety disorders
  • Cancer
  • Epilepsy
  • Multiple sclerosis
  • Crohn’s disease
  • Parkinson’s disease
  • Severe or chronic nausea
  • Other conditions of the same kind or class as those enumerated here

To officially determine your eligibility, a licensed marijuana doctor needs to assess your health condition and conclude whether cannabis would be an effective treatment.

How a Medical Marijuana Doctor Determines Eligibility

Eligibility for a medical marijuana card in Florida is determined through:

  • Comprehensive review of your medical history
  • Discussion of your current symptoms
  • Evaluation of existing diagnoses
  • Assessment of the potential therapeutic benefits of cannabis for your condition

Step-by-Step: How to Get a Florida Medical Marijuana Card

The process of obtaining a medical marijuana card in Florida involves several straightforward steps:

  1. Schedule an appointment with a certified marijuana doctor at MCCFL.
  2. Receive your physician’s certification if you meet the eligibility criteria.
  3. Register with the Florida Medical Marijuana Use Registry.
  4. Once approved, purchase your medical cannabis from licensed dispensaries.
